[Detailed Description of the Invention] [Industrial Application Field] The present invention relates to a suspension structure for a parking pallet used in a multi-level parking device such as a two-level, three-level, etc. parking system.

Conventionally, as a multi-stage parking system using a suspension chain, a two-stage parking system disclosed in Japanese Utility Model Publication No. 44-17936 or a system with a suspension structure as shown in FIG. 3 has been provided.

The two-stage parking device shown in the above utility model publication uses suspension chains to raise and lower the parking pallets at appropriate positions on both ends, and each of the suspension chains is suspended from sprockets provided on the cross beams and hoisted up and down evenly by a motor. Therefore, the entire load of the parking pallet and the cars parked there is applied to the long cross beams, so strong cross beams must be prepared, and if the cross beams are weak, they may warp due to long-term use. It was hot.

The same applies to the conventional example shown in FIG.
That is, one end of a suspension chain 21 is fixed to a suitable position in the direction of both ends of the parking pallet 20, and the suspension chain 21 is suspended from a guide sprocket 23 provided on a cross beam 22 above the fixed portion, and further It was suspended from a hoisting sprocket 25 which was suspended from an idler 26 provided on a support column 24 and rotated by a motor.

Therefore, all the loads of the parking pallet 20 and the cars parked thereon were applied to the cross beams.

The present invention eliminates the above-mentioned drawbacks, and instead of suspending all of the suspension chains on the cross beam, the suspension chain at one end is suspended on a guide sprocket provided from the column that supports the cross beam. It is structured as follows.

In order to eliminate the above-mentioned drawbacks, the present invention has one end of a suspension chain fixed to each of approximately four corners of a parking pallet placed between cross beams installed between columns constituting a parking space. The chain is suspended on a guide sprocket provided from a side beam above the attachment part, and the other end of the hanging chain is suspended on a guide sprocket provided from a support above the attachment part, and the chain is coaxial with the guide sprocket. The suspension chain on the side beam side is suspended from a guide sprocket provided above, and can be hoisted evenly by a motor.

In the present invention, a parking pallet 1 is raised and lowered by two front suspension chains 6 and two rear suspension chains 6a. The suspension chain at one end, specifically the front suspension chain 6, is suspended from a guide sprocket 7 provided from the cross beam 5 above the attachment part with the parking pallet 1, and the suspension chain at the other end, specifically, The rear suspension chain 6a is suspended from a guide sprocket 8 provided from the support 4 above the attachment point with the parking pallet 1, and each suspension chain 6 and 6a is connected to the motor 1.
2 allows for even winding.

Therefore, the load applied to the cross beams is halved, making strong cross beams unnecessary. Furthermore, since one of the suspension chains is moved toward the support column, the effective space is widened and does not interfere with pedestrians when loading and unloading cars, and the idler 26 in the embodiment shown in FIG. 3 is not required, making it economical. It also has the advantage that the suspension chain is difficult to come off.
